Frequently asked questions
Illinois: 110 applications in 2025, of which 88 were originated and 9 denied.
8.2% of all applications, or 9.2% of the applications it actually decided on. The Illinois statewide average across all lenders was 17.1%.
This lender did not report interest rates on its originated loans (some institutions are exempt from HMDA pricing fields).
About this data. Figures are International Bank of Chicago's own HMDA filing for properties located in Illinois, 2025. The grade is national; state-level figures are shown for context and are not separately graded. Methodology
